Much of the foundational 3D framework used across historical naval mods traces back to the Virtual Titanic Project led by Kyle Hudak. Hudak's work redefined what was possible within the game engine, offering fully modeled bridge layouts and high-accuracy exterior decks that served as a gold standard for later creators. It must be noted that the Titanic available for VS NG is largely a product of the simulation’s passionate modding community. While the base game includes several liners, the definitive high-detail Titanic (often labeled “Titanic Ultimate” or “Titanic V4”) is a fan-made labor of love. Textures, sound packs (creaking hulls, orchestra music over the intercom), and even lifeboat davit mechanics are shared on forums like Virtual Sailor Simulator and Shipsim.com .
